Role Purpose

The Product Engineer is responsible for assisting the Product Lead(s) in design, modification and documentation of Spectainer products.

Reporting to: Product Lead

Location: Singapore

Role Accountabilities

  • Support the final stages of Spectainer’s COLLAPSECON & COS design, prepare technical drawings, specification, BOM, prepared parts list, production drawings, patent drawings, and other technical documentation.
  • Assist in developing new design concepts.
  • Assist in the durability assessments of all OEM parts and components to ensure the components/parts are able to meet the company’s target useful lifecycle
  • Assist in preparing test schedules to ensure products operational efficiency.
  • Collaborate with service team to write the maintenance manuals and repair tariff, and testing requirements to ensure the COLLAPSECON meets the durability and operating standard, and conform with the onsite safety standard under guidance of the Product Lead.
  • Ensure that all technical documentation is up-to-date.
  • Assist in the provision of cross-functional support to ensure COLLAPSECON & COS are successfully implemented.
  • Assist in the provision of onsite training to operators and supervise the entire set-up process to ensure the COLLAPSECON is fully operable and commissioned.

Your day-to-day duties will typically consist of:

  • Using computer aided engineering and design software and equipment to perform drafting and design.
  • Liaising with the whole Product Team as well as outside stakeholders in monitoring the day-to-day production.
  • Liaising with suppliers for design and construction information and documentation.
  • Developing design for new product concepts.
  • Partaking in the analysis of research data and proposed product specifications to determine feasibility of designs.
  • Drafting technical documentation including manufacturing and quality assurance drawings assemblies and components in addition to other clerical and document control activities.
  • Assisting in the experimental test programs to ensure designs meet final product specifications.
  • Analysing test data and technical reports to determine if current and/or new designs and products meet functional and performance specifications.
